2011 (3) TMI 1189 - CESTAT, MUMBAITransfer of appeal - application filed by the assessee with the South Zonal Bench for transfer of the department's appeal to the West Zonal Bench on the ground that their registered office is situated at Mumbai, the South Zonal Bench ordered transfer of that appeal, later on, bench took note of Public Notice and ordered transfer of both the appeals to South Zonal Bench (Chennai) - Assistant Registrar of the Chennai Bench sent a letter requesting for obtaining the approval of the Hon'ble President and forwarding the same - Held that:- Had the present appeals been filed on or after 5.8.2005 with the Zonal bench concerned (Chennai), the appeals would have been heard by that bench. Prior to 5.8.2005, it was open to a party to file appeal with the Principal Bench or with a Zonal bench and then seek transfer to the jurisdictional bench. This is what was done by the party in the present case, who filed their appeal with this bench and sought transfer of the department's appeal from Chennai bench to this bench on the ground that their registered office is situated in Mumbai. The transfer application was not opposed. This view of ours is at variance with the view taken by the bench on 29.9.2010. Therefore, in the interest of judicial discipline, we would like to have the Hon'ble President's decision in the matter before proceeding to hear the appeals. Accordingly, the Assistant Registrar is directed to place the records along with a certified copy of this order before the Hon'ble President without delay.
